Emma Hayes is urging her Chelsea team to secure qualification for the knock-out stages of the Women’s Champions League tonight. They can do that with victory over bottom of Group D Real Madrid. The two sides played out a 2-2 draw in Spain, earlier in the competition. Kick off is 8pm.
